Potential VA Home Loan Advantages
Qualified borrowers may be eligible to purchase a home with no down payment.
VA financing generally does not require monthly private mortgage insurance.
Competitive financing terms may be available through participating lenders.
Certain closing-cost protections may apply.
Eligible borrowers may be able to use their VA benefit more than once.
Loan eligibility, financing terms, costs, property requirements, and approval are determined by the U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s and participating lenders. The Resilient Home Group provides real estate guidance and does not provide lending, legal, or tax advice.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I purchase an Orlando home with no down payment using a VA loan?
Qualified VA borrowers may be eligible for zero-down-payment financing. A participating VA lender must confirm eligibility, available entitlement, property qualifications, and final approval.
Can a first-time homebuyer use a VA loan?
Yes. Eligible veterans, service members, and surviving spouses may potentially use VA financing for their first home.
Can I use my VA home loan benefit more than once?
Many eligible veterans can reuse their benefit. The amount of remaining entitlement and whether restoration is required depend on the borrower’s circumstances and must be confirmed by the VA or a qualified lender.
Can I purchase a condominium using VA financing?
Potentially, but the condominium project may need to satisfy VA requirements. Your lender can verify the project’s approval status and available options.
Is a VA appraisal the same as a home inspection?
No. An appraisal assesses value and applicable VA property requirements. A home inspection is a separate evaluation of the property’s condition and is strongly recommended.
Can a seller reject an offer that uses VA financing?
A seller may evaluate and select among the offers received. Victor helps VA buyers prepare competitive offers and communicates clearly with the listing side about the transaction.
How much money will I need at closing?
Although qualified borrowers may not need a down payment, expenses such as inspections, appraisal charges, earnest money, prepaid costs, and allowable closing costs may still apply. Your lender and closing professionals will provide estimates based on your transaction.
